Depth Penetration Analysis
The depth of penetration of a moisture meter is a crucial factor to consider when selecting the right device for your needs. Different meters offer varying penetration depths:
- Shallow penetration meters are ideal for surface measurements, such as on drywall or wood flooring.
- Medium penetration meters reach deeper into the material, making them suitable for most applications.
- Deep penetration meters are best for measuring moisture levels in thicker materials, such as concrete or large logs.
Factors Affecting Moisture Measurement
Several factors can affect the accuracy of moisture meter readings, including:
- Material type – Different materials have different electrical properties, affecting the meter’s readings.
- Temperature and humidity – Changes in temperature and humidity can influence the meter’s calibration.
- Meter calibration – It is essential to calibrate your moisture meter regularly to ensure accurate readings.
